A crisp, herbal fortified wine, dry vermouth brings botanical complexity to cocktails like the Martini and Gibson. Its balanced bitterness and subtle sweetness enhance savory dishes when used in cooking. Bartenders, home mixologists, and foodies benefit from its versatility, adding depth to both drinks and recipes.
